Saltearse al contenido

Importar en bloque — traer sus datos desde CSV

La función Importar en bloque de Habitia trae todo un portafolio desde archivos CSV en una sola sesión — útil cuando se están mudando de una hoja de cálculo, otra herramienta o registros en papel. El proceso corre en un orden fijo, y cada paso hace referencia a los nombres del paso anterior.

Nota: Solo los roles admin y gerente ven la página de Importar en bloque.

Cuándo usar Importar en bloque

  • Cuando se están cambiando a Habitia desde una hoja de cálculo u otra herramienta.
  • Cuando tienen más de 10 propiedades o más de 20 unidades, y agregarlas una por una tomaría todo el día.
  • No para el día a día — una vez configurados, usen los botones regulares de Agregar.

1. Abran la página de Importar en bloque

Desde el menú lateral, hagan clic en Importar en bloque (icono de subida). La página los lleva por cinco tipos de entidad en un orden fijo:

propiedades → unidades → espacios → activos → contratos

Cada paso depende del anterior, así que el orden importa.

Screenshot: página de Importar en bloque con la franja de las cinco entidades

2. Descarguen la plantilla CSV

Cada tarjeta de entidad tiene un botón Descargar plantilla. Hagan clic — recibirán un archivo <entidad>_template.csv con la fila de encabezados que Habitia espera, más una fila de comentarios con pistas para cada columna.

Ábranlo en Numbers, Excel, Google Sheets — lo que usen.

Consejo: No renombren ni eliminen las columnas del encabezado. Habitia identifica los campos por el nombre del encabezado. Si borran o cambian un encabezado, ese campo no se va a importar.

3. Llenen sus datos

Algunas reglas por fila:

  • Propiedades primero. Requerido. Cada CSV posterior hace referencia a las propiedades por nombre. Usen nombres que reconozcan (“Calle Luna 12” funciona; “Propiedad A” no).
  • Las unidades hacen referencia a la propiedad por su nombre exacto. Igualen mayúsculas y ortografía.
  • Espacios y activos son opcionales. Sálten estos pasos si no llevan control de habitaciones o electrodomésticos individualmente.
  • Los contratos crean inquilinos automáticamente. Si un inquilino en su CSV todavía no existe en Habitia, se crea a partir del correo y el nombre. No tienen que importar inquilinos por separado.

4. Suban un CSV a la vez

  1. Guarden el CSV con los datos.
  2. En la página de Importar en bloque, hagan clic en Subir CSV debajo de la tarjeta de la entidad correspondiente.
  3. Esperen. Verán uno de dos resultados:
    • N filas importadas (check verde) — éxito.
    • N filas omitidas (triángulo naranja) — algunas filas fallaron la validación. La página se expande para mostrar cada error con número de fila, nombre del campo y mensaje. Arreglen el CSV y vuelvan a subir — Habitia salta las filas que ya existen, así que pueden volver a subir el archivo completo sin problema.

Nota: Cada subida es de compromiso parcial. Las filas válidas se insertan, las inválidas se omiten y se reportan. No hay reversión atómica — si 95 de 100 filas pasan, esas 95 quedan adentro.

5. Sigan a la próxima entidad

Una vez las propiedades estén adentro, hagan las unidades. Después, opcionalmente, espacios y activos. Después, contratos. Hacer las cosas fuera de orden va a generar errores, porque los CSV posteriores hacen referencia a nombres que todavía no existen.

Tamaño y formato del archivo

  • Máximo 5 MB por archivo (aproximadamente 50,000 filas — mucho más allá de cualquier portafolio real de un solo dueño).
  • Solo CSV (.csv). Los archivos de Excel no funcionan — exporten a CSV primero.
  • UTF-8 es lo más seguro. Si su CSV tiene acentos o ñ, guárdenlo como UTF-8 para que los caracteres sobrevivan la subida.

Errores comunes y cómo arreglarlos

Mensaje de errorQué significa
”Property not found”El nombre de la propiedad en esta fila no coincide con ninguna propiedad que hayan importado. Revisen ortografía y mayúsculas.
”Required field missing”Una columna requerida está en blanco. La fila de comentarios de la plantilla marca cuáles campos son requeridos.
”Invalid date”La fecha no está en formato YYYY-MM-DD. Usen 2026-05-12, no 5/12/26.
”Unit already exists”Ese número de unidad ya existe en esa propiedad. Habitia salta el duplicado.

Próximo paso

  • Agregar una propiedad — para agregar más después de terminar la importación.
  • Enviar un contrato para firma — para los contratos que entraron en borrador y ahora necesitan firmas.